Show Ad Club, University To Team for Series on Advertising An important "first" for educational edu-cational television will be scored later this month when the Salt Lake Advertising Club and University Uni-versity of Utah team to present a series of telecasts on advertising advertis-ing over the university's educational educa-tional outlet, KUED-TV, Channel Chan-nel 7. Line-up of talent for the programs pro-grams reads like a "Who's Who" of the Utah advertising profession. profes-sion. The weekly series of telecasts tele-casts will begin on Channel 7 on Tuesday, March 31 at 9:30 p.m. The course, "Principles of Effective Ef-fective Advertising" will made for businessmen who need to know more about getting the most from their advertising dollars, dol-lars, as well as for students. First program of the series, "What is Advertising," will bel presented by Dr. O. Preston Robinson, Rob-inson, general manager of the Deseret News Publishing Company. Com-pany. Top experts of the various phases of advertising will then, follow each Tuesday until the series is concluded on June 2. The University of Utah will include the series as a part of a Marketing Department and Extension Ex-tension Divison class on advertising adver-tising which will meet at the KUED studio. Utah State and Brigham Young universities have also indicated an interest in the series and are expected to include in-clude the programs in advertising advertis-ing classes at those schools. In announcing the telecasts, Herbert L. Price, Ad Club president, presi-dent, said that the "goal of our series this year is to reach more people wit useful, basic information infor-mation on advertising methods and policies. "We feel this is especially important im-portant for students preparing to enter the field, as well as for businessmen who are responsible for advertising decisions and expenditures ex-penditures for their organizations." organiza-tions." The ten wek series will'be co-sponsored co-sponsored by the Salt Lake Ad Club and the University of Utah department of marketing, exten-sion exten-sion division, and KUED. |
